Transaction e1caeb14a80961c688b36a98f76daf63a2d6b064f97dcc4a50f5d9256abf9397
1 Input
1 Output
-
e1caeb14a80961c688b36a98f76daf63a2d6b064f97dcc4a50f5d9256abf9397:0
- value
- 1255923
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9ddf5d51676803f3580eec5271bafa5652cd03c31c3b98936dcf71ad3ffb6df6
- address
- bc1pnh0465t8dqplxkqwa3f8rwh62efv6q7rrsae3ymdeac660lmdhmq6qpe6a